Weave Code
Code Weaver
Helps Laravel developers discover, compare, and choose open-source packages. See popularity, security, maintainers, and scores at a glance to make better decisions.
Feedback
Share your thoughts, report bugs, or suggest improvements.
Subject
Message

Filament Astrotomic Laravel Package

cactus-galaxy/filament-astrotomic

View on GitHub
Deep Wiki
Context7

Product Decisions This Supports

  • Multilingual Content Management: Enables seamless translation support for Filament admin panels, allowing teams to manage localized content (e.g., e-commerce product descriptions, blog posts, or CMS pages) without duplicating resources.
  • Build vs. Buy: Avoids reinventing translation workflows in Filament by leveraging an existing, well-integrated package (Astrotomic’s laravel-translatable), reducing dev time and technical debt.
  • Roadmap Prioritization: Justifies investing in Filament for global teams or markets where multilingual support is a must-have (e.g., SaaS platforms, international enterprises, or localized SaaS products).
  • UX Consistency: Standardizes translation handling across Filament resources, improving developer experience and reducing onboarding time for new team members.
  • Localization for Non-Technical Users: Empowers content editors (e.g., marketing teams) to manage translations directly via Filament’s intuitive UI, reducing reliance on backend developers.

When to Consider This Package

  • Adopt when:

    • Your Laravel app uses Filament for admin panels and requires multilingual content (e.g., dynamic translations for models like Post, Product, or Page).
    • You’re already using Astrotomic’s laravel-translatable (or willing to migrate) and want a Filament-specific integration (vs. Spatie’s alternative).
    • Your team prioritizes developer velocity over custom solutions—this package provides pre-built UI components for translation management.
    • You need fallback language support, JSON-based translations, or scoped translations (e.g., per-tenant in multitenancy apps).
  • Look elsewhere when:

    • You’re using Spatie’s laravel-translatable and prefer their Filament plugin (more stars, active maintenance).
    • Your translation needs are simple (e.g., static strings via Laravel’s built-in localization) and don’t require model-level translations.
    • You’re using a different admin panel (e.g., Nova, Backpack) or a headless CMS (e.g., Strapi, Directus).
    • Your app requires advanced features (e.g., machine translation APIs, collaborative editing) not covered by this package.

How to Pitch It (Stakeholders)

For Executives: "This package lets us build a scalable, multilingual admin panel in Filament with minimal dev effort. By integrating Astrotomic’s translation system, we can support global content (e.g., localized product pages, blog posts) without custom code. It’s a drop-in solution that aligns with our Filament roadmap, reducing time-to-market for international features. Think of it as ‘Google Translate for our admin tools’—but built for developers and editors."

For Engineering: *"This is a lightweight, battle-tested way to add translations to Filament resources. It:

  • Saves 2–4 weeks of dev time vs. building from scratch.
  • Works with Astrotomic’s laravel-translatable, which we’re already using (or can adopt).
  • Provides a clean UI for editors to manage translations (e.g., toggle languages, edit fields per locale).
  • Leverages Filament’s ecosystem—no need to reinvent the wheel for CRUD + translations. Downside: Smaller community than Spatie’s plugin, but the code is simple and well-documented. Let’s prototype it for [X use case] and compare with Spatie’s alternative."*

For Product/Design: *"This tool will let non-technical teams (e.g., marketing, localization) manage translations directly in Filament. For example:

  • A content manager can edit a blog post in English, Spanish, and French from one screen.
  • No more CSV exports/imports or backend tickets—self-service localization. Ask: Which Filament resources (e.g., Products, Pages) should we prioritize for this feature?"*
Weaver

How can I help you explore Laravel packages today?

Conversation history is not saved when not logged in.
Prompt
Add packages to context
No packages found.
hamzi/corewatch
minionfactory/raw-hydrator
hexters/coinpayment
rjcodes/rjcms
act-training/laravel-permissions-manager
alimarchal/laravel-chart-of-accounts
babenkoivan/elastic-scout-driver
mkwebdesign/filament-watchdog-v5
renatomarinho/laravel-page-speed
zedmagdy/filament-business-hours
renatovdemoura/blade-elements-ui
devgeek/beacon-admin
benjamin-rqt/data-watcher-bundle
atriumphp/atrium
sandermuller/package-boost-laravel
sandermuller/boost-skills
redaxo/core
yusufgenc/filament-api-forge
l3aro/rating-star-for-filament
leek/filament-subtenant-scope